Gus Poyet reaffirms interest in Republic of Ireland job

Gus Poyet has once again courted the possibility of becoming the next Republic of Ireland manager as his contract with Greece enters its final few months.

After the Greeks' 2-0 win at the Aviva Stadium in October, Poyet went out of his way to praise the Irish fans.

"It is a big plus for us to have this situation now and be able to beat the Republic of Ireland twice because, I tell you, the support in here... I would like to be in charge of the team here," he said.

"I would love that. I would absolutely love that. I think it is a terrific place to come and play football. I was even surprised coming from the hotel, watching the people. I pay attention a lot. How many people have got the tracksuit? The black one. How many people have the green. Listen, in Uruguay we are patriots, but I don't think many people buy the national team tracksuit.

"I don’t remember, maybe I am wrong. The shirt? Yes. But I don’t think many people buy the tracksuit. They are there with the tracksuit, it is proper. It is proper."

It's unusual for an opposing manager to deliver such praise for set of fans, but Poyet has doubled down on his admiration for Ireland.

In an interview with LiveScore, he said: "My contract finishes in March. So, finish the [Euro 2024] play-off games and it’s over. It doesn’t matter if I qualify or not because there is no extension.

"We used to say when you’re a player, six months left on your contract and you can start looking for a job.

"Now, that is a possibility that they [Ireland] will like me, that they will contact me. That’s a different matter.

"I congratulated them because the atmosphere was spectacular. It was a pleasure. The future will tell."
